The 1916 Primera División was the fifth season of top-flight Peruvian football. Nine teams competed in the league. The champion was Sport José Gálvez.[1] It was organized by the homonymous entity, Liga Peruana de Football (Peruvian Football League), currently known as Professional Football Sports Association.
